AMA Research have published the 2nd Edition of the ‘Insulation Market - UK 2007’. The report incorporates original research and provides a detailed review of the market for insulation products in domestic, industrial and commercial applications.

Product areas covered in detail in the report are:-

  • Mineral fibre products - Glass wool, Stone wool.
  • Foam insulation products - Polyurethane / Polyisocyanurate, Phenolic & Polystyrene
  • Other materials - Cellulose, Cork, Sheep' s Wool etc.

With a 2006 market value of over £650 million msp, the market for building insulation products is undergoing a phase of substantial growth, largely underpinned by the impact of Government initiatives, the most significant being the Energy Efficiency Commitment (EEC) and the Fuel Poverty programmes. Other key market drivers have been: -the impact of the changes to the Building Regulations - Part L 2002 and Part E 2003 - increasing levels of new housing output, the recovery in office newbuild and the impact of several hikes in the prices of a broad range of insulation products since 2005.

Over the period 2007 - 2011, we anticipate that growth will accelerate with the implementation of the Carbon Emissions Reduction Target (CERT) - to run for a 3-year period from 1 April 2008 - as it is to significantly increase the targets set under EEC. Other factors that should drive up demand will include increased levels of activity in commercial offices, schools and healthcare construction combined with the impact of the 2006 changes to Part L of the Building Regulations.
